Fluke 1587 FC Insulation Fluke Connect helps you identify tough problems, fix, and wirelessly communicate your work quickly and easily – all at a safe distance. The Fluke 1587 FC Insulation Test Voltages are :50, 100, 250, 500, 1000 V PI/DAR timed ratio tests with TrendIt™ graphs to identify moisture and contaminated insulation problems faster Memory storage through Fluke Connect that saves measurements to your phone or the cloud and eliminates the need to write down results.
